Abstract

The utility model provides a special device for grouting a deep hole in a crushing section of a surrounding rock. The special device comprises a grouting pipe (1) and a blocking pipe (2) which is sleeved on the grouting pipe (1) and has a certain gap with the grouting pipe (1), wherein the roots of the grouting pipe (1) and the blocking pipe (2) are welded on a first flange disc (7), the front end of the blocking pipe (2) is welded on the outer wall of the grouting pipe (1) in an inward bending manner, an auxiliary grouting pipe (5) with the inner end is communicated with the gap between the grouting pipe (1) and the blocking pipe (2) is connected to the wall pipe of the blocking pipe (2), and a plurality of strip-type penetration holes (3) are formed in the pipe wall of the blocking pipe (2). Through the auxiliary grouting pipe which is filled in the grouting pipe and the gap between the blocking pipe and a grouting hole as well as a crack on a grouting hole wall, the slurry loop after filling the crack is still in a closed state, and a main grouting pipe during grouting does not eject the cured slurry in the crack, thus, an orifice pipe is prevented from falling and the surrounding rock is prevented from collapsing.

Background technology
Due to unstable rock, the reason such as hydrostatic hydraulic pressure is large, water yield is large, when rock crusher section is carried out deep hole grouting, in crack on slip casting hole wall, can gush out with water and the slurry of elevated pressures, the water that these are gushed out and slurry direction outside hole promotes Grouting Pipe, causes the situation that in slip casting process, orifice tube comes off to happen occasionally.The means that address this problem are at present mainly: the first, beat in addition auxiliary injected hole, and first shutoff crack recycles orifice tube slip casting after maintenance.The major defect of this mode is: long construction period, and slurry curing in crack can be ejected at later stage orifice tube slip casting process mesohigh slurry, cause country rock to cave in.The second, the prefabricated concrete wall with injected hole, the injected hole slip casting on these concrete wall, to utilize the plugging action of concrete wall.The shortcoming of this mode is, needs dismantling concrete wall after mortar depositing construction, long construction period not only, and also engineering cost is too high.

The specific embodiment
Below in conjunction with drawings and Examples, further illustrate the utility model.
As shown in Figure 1, the utility model comprises the Grouting Pipe 1 of seamless steel pipe form and is enclosed within outside Grouting Pipe 1 and has the shutoff pipe 2 of the seamless steel pipe form of certain interval with Grouting Pipe 1.During making, adopt two kinds of different seamless steel pipe welding processing of external diameter to form, shutoff pipe 2 external diameters are generally little 3~5 millimeters than injected hole diameter.Shutoff pipe 2 length depend on grouting pressure, and general 3~5 meters can meet the demands.Grouting Pipe 1 external diameter is slightly smaller than the interior diameter of shutoff pipe 2, but length must be longer than shutoff pipe 2, generally long 0.5~2 meter.The wall thickness of Grouting Pipe 1 and 2 two kinds of seamless steel pipes of shutoff pipe is selected according to grouting pressure, and general 6~10 millimeters can meet the demands.Add man-hour, Grouting Pipe 1 and shutoff pipe 2 roots are all welded on the first flange 7, guarantee leakproof; Be welded on the outer wall of Grouting Pipe 1 to the inside bending of front end of shutoff pipe 2.And on the tube wall of shutoff pipe 2, be connected with that gap between inner and Grouting Pipe 1 and shutoff pipe 2 communicates, outer end is with the auxiliary Grouting Pipe 5 of the first valve 6.
On shutoff pipe 2 from its front end backward 2.0m left and right scope internal cutting process several bar shapeds and thoroughly starch hole 3, make can thoroughly to starch hole 3 by bar shaped from the slurries of assisting Grouting Pipe 5 to enter and be filled in the gap between Grouting Pipe 1 and shutoff pipe 2 and injected hole, and in the crack on slip casting hole wall.
The tube wall of shutoff pipe 2 is provided with several little solder joint 4 ,Gai Chanma districts, Chan Ma district and is positioned between auxiliary Grouting Pipe 5 roots and bar shaped Tou Jiangkong 3rd district.The object that arranges of little solder joint is the frictional force that increases the Chan Ma district rope made of hemp and tube wall.
The utility model also comprises Grouting Pipe 8 outside hole as shown in Figure 2 further, outside hole, one end band of Grouting Pipe 8 is useful on second flange 9 in mating connection with described the first flange 7, the other end is connected with high pressure sluice valve 12, and outside hole, the tube wall of Grouting Pipe 8 is also connected with the main Grouting Pipe 10 with the second valve 11.The first flange 7 and the second flange 9 same models, Grouting Pipe 8 and shutoff pipe 2 same models outside hole.
Aid shown in Fig. 3 comprises the tapping pipe 13 that offers spilled water hole 15 on tube wall, and one end of this tapping pipe 13 is with the blind plate 14 of this tapping pipe 13 of shutoff, and the other end is with adpting flange 16.Adpting flange 16 and the first flange 7 same models, tapping pipe 13 and shutoff pipe 2 same models.
Operating principle:
First the first flange 7 is connected to ,Chan Ma district with adpting flange 16 use high-strength bolts and is wrapped with after appropriate fiber crops, front end is placed in injected hole, then with round log, clash into blind plate 14, until first flange 7 the place ahead parts are headed in hole.At this process mesopore inner high voltage water, by Grouting Pipe 1 and tapping pipe 13, through spilled water hole 15, flow out pressure release, this greatly reduces the resistance that heads into injected hole.The fiber crops in Chan Ma district play resistance effect.
After fixation, the first valve 6 be connected with slurry filling machine and open the first valve 6, with high-pressure grout injector, carrying out grouting and reinforcing.Then maintenance is about 24 hours.
Lay down aid, docking that the second flange 9 of Grouting Pipe outside hole 8 is matched with the first flange 7, opens high pressure sluice valve 12 in docking operation, forms drainage gallery pressure release, is beneficial to smooth connection.
After connection, close high pressure sluice valve 12, the second valve 11 is connected to slurry filling machine and opens the second valve 11, utilize main Grouting Pipe 10 to carry out slip casting, until grouting for water blocking is complete.
